C / C++ / Java / .NET Programming Internship – 10 Days, 15 Days, 30 Days or More Practical Training

C / C++ / Java / .NET Programming Internship

IntroductionĀ 
C, C++, Java, and .NET are some of the most widely used programming technologies in the world.

    • C: Known as the foundation of modern programming, used for system-level development.
    • C++: An extension of C with object-oriented features, ideal for high-performance applications.
    • Java: A platform-independent language popular for enterprise applications, Android development, and backend systems.
    • .NET: A Microsoft framework for building scalable web, desktop, and enterprise applications.

These technologies are core skills for software developers, forming the base for many advanced programming fields.

Who Can Join

  • Engineering StudentsĀ 
    • CSE, IT, ECE, EEE, and related branches.
  • Diploma StudentsĀ 
    • Diploma in CSE, IT, or Electronics who want hands-on coding exposure.
  • Arts & Science Students
    • B.Sc / M.Sc (Computer Science, Physics, Maths, Commerce), BCA, MCA.
  • Commerce & Management StudentsĀ 
    • B.Com (CA), BBA, MBA students interested in application development basics.
  • Beginners & Final Year Students
    • Those working on mini/major academic projects or preparing for IT placements.
  • Anyone interested in software development and application programming.

How Programming is Taught at Prasartech

At Prasartech Projects and Solution, we provide structured training in each programming language, starting from basic syntax to advanced application development. Students work on practical projects to master programming logic, data structures, algorithms, and software architecture.

Industry-Relevant Skills

Interns will gain expertise in:

    • C & C++: Syntax, functions, pointers, memory management, object-oriented programming.
    • Java: Core Java, OOP concepts, collections, multithreading, JDBC, and frameworks.
    • .NET: C#, ASP.NET, ADO.NET, and application deployment.
    • Problem-solving and algorithm design.

Hands-On Project Work

    • Console-based applications in C and C++.
    • Java desktop or Android applications.
    • Web applications using ASP.NET and database integration.
    • Software modules for automation and business solutions.

Expert Mentorship

Mentors guide students through debugging techniques, optimization, and best coding practices. Code reviews and project-based learning ensure that students gain practical skills for real-world software development.

Outcome

    • Strong foundation in multiple programming languages.
    • Ability to design, develop, and deploy applications across different platforms.

Photo Gallery